DESIGN AWARDS


You are here:  Company > Design Awards

At Parsons & Whittley, we are very proud of the numerous awards which have been presented to our practice over the years. The awards recognise the design skills of our architects, and are a testament to the entire team's commitment and hard work.

Our achievements to date include:

  LABC "Built in Quality" Award (2008)
Design Category: Best Housing or Residential Development
Project: Residential Flats in Kings Lynn.
 
  King's Lynn & West Norfolk Borough Council: Mayor's Award (2006)
Design Category: Domestic Extension (Commendation)
Project: The Lodge in Barton Bendish.
 
  King's Lynn & West Norfolk Borough Council: Mayor's Award (2000)
Design Category: Domestic Extension
Project: The Royal Station in Wolferton.
 
  King's Lynn & West Norfolk Borough Council: Mayor's Award (2000)
Design Category: Commercial Building
Project: The Philip Cousins Workshop in Downham Market.
 
  Breckland District Council: Ian Howard Award (2000)
Project: Barn Conversion, Oxborough
Principal Designer: Malcolm Whittley
 
  King's Lynn & West Norfolk Borough Council: Mayor's Award (1999)
Design Category: New Housing
Project: Buttlands Lane Cottages and Hyde House in Barton Bendish.
 
  Breckland District Council: Ian Howard Award (1997)
Project: Church Conversion, Hardingham
Principal Designer: Malcolm Whittley
 
  Norfolk Association of Architects: Craftsmanship Award (1989)
Project: Extensions to Thursford Collection, Fakenham
Principal Designer: Malcolm Whittley
